The judicial system serving Gibsonia is primarily housed within the Allegheny County Court, which includes the Superior, District, and Court of Common Pleass. Those wishing to request court records can do so through the court's online portal or by visiting the clerk's office in person. Vital records, including birth, death, and marriage certificates, can be obtained from the Allegheny County Clerk-Recorder or through the Pennsylvania Department of Health's vital records division. Property records, which are crucial for various transactions and ownership verification, are managed by the county assessor and recorder, with online access available for ease of retrieval. Residents may submit general public records requests under the Pennsylvania Right-to-Know Law, which mandates a typical response time of 5 to 10 business days. Allegheny County Recorder of Deeds
Property records for Gibsonia, Pennsylvania are maintained by the Allegheny County Recorder of Deeds. This office maintains recorded documents including deeds, mortgages, liens, and easements for properties in Allegheny County, including Gibsonia.
